Flutter — это открытая платформа для разработки мобильных приложений, которая позволяет создавать красивые и высокопроизводительные приложения для операционных систем Android и iOS. Однако, перед тем как начать разработку в Flutter, необходимо установить и настроить его окружение на вашей рабочей машине.
В этой пошаговой инструкции мы покажем, как установить Flutter на операционную систему Windows. Данный процесс несложен, но требует следования определенным шагам, чтобы убедиться, что все основные компоненты установлены и настроены правильно.
Прежде всего, для установки Flutter вам понадобится рабочая станция под управлением Windows с установленным программным обеспечением Git. Если у вас уже установлен Git, то вы готовы начать. В противном случае, вам необходимо установить Git с официального сайта https://git-scm.com/downloads.
После установки Git, следуйте этим шагам:
Шаг 1: Откройте терминал Git Bash, нажав правой кнопкой мыши на рабочем столе или в папке, и выберите «Git Bash Here». Это откроет командную строку Git Bash.
Шаг 2: В командной строке Git Bash введите следующую команду для скачивания Flutter SDK:
git clone https://github.com/flutter/flutter.git
Шаг 3: После завершения загрузки SDK переместите папку flutter в желаемую директорию на вашем компьютере.
Шаг 4: Далее, добавьте путь к SDK Flutter в переменную среды PATH. Для этого откройте окно «Система» в «Параметры» (нажмите Win + X и выберите «Система»), затем перейдите во вкладку «Дополнительные параметры системы», и нажмите на кнопку «Переменные среды». В разделе «Переменные среды для [Ваше имя пользователя]» найдите переменную среды PATH и нажмите «Изменить». Добавьте путь к папке flutter/bin в поле «Значение переменной» и нажмите «ОК».
Поздравляю! Теперь у вас установлена и настроена Flutter на Windows. Вы можете использовать Flutter командой «flutter» в командной строке для проверки успешности установки. Также, не забудьте установить Android Studio и настроить эмулятор Android для разработки приложений под Android, а также Xcode для разработки приложений под iOS.
Следуя этой пошаговой инструкции, вы сможете быстро и легко установить и настроить Flutter на своей Windows-машине, что позволит вам начать разработку мобильных приложений в этой инновационной и мощной платформе.
Подготовка к установке Flutter
Для успешной установки Flutter на Windows необходимо выполнить несколько предварительных шагов:
- Убедитесь, что ваш компьютер отвечает системным требованиям для работы с Flutter. Требуется 64-разрядная версия Windows 7 или новее, процессор поддерживающий характеристики для виртуализации и 4 ГБ оперативной памяти.
- Установите Git на ваш компьютер, если он ещё не установлен. Git будет использоваться для загрузки и обновления распределенного репозитория Flutter.
- Убедитесь, что Flutter SDK и Android Studio не конфликтуют между собой. Проверьте, что Flutter SDK не будет использоваться в качестве расширения Android Studio, и если вы ранее устанавливали Flutter через Android Studio, удалите его перед установкой отдельной Flutter SDK.
- Установите Dart SDK. Dart — язык программирования, на котором написан Flutter. Вы можете установить Dart SDK с официального сайта Dart или использовать встроенный Dart SDK в Flutter.
- Настройте переменную среды PATH. Добавьте путь к Flutter SDK и путь к Dart SDK в переменную среды PATH, чтобы иметь доступ к командам Flutter и Dart из любой директории в командной строке или терминале.
После выполнения этих предварительных шагов вы будете готовы к установке Flutter на ваш компьютер с Windows и начать разработку с помощью этого инструмента.
Скачивание и установка Flutter SDK
Для начала разработки на Flutter необходимо скачать и установить Flutter SDK. В этом разделе будет описан процесс скачивания и установки.
Шаг 1: Проверьте требования
Перед установкой Flutter SDK убедитесь, что ваша операционная система соответствует следующим требованиям:
- Windows 7 SP1 и более поздние версии (64-разрядные)
- 4 ГБ оперативной памяти и более
- 2 ГБ свободного дискового пространства
- Процессор с поддержкой многопоточности
Проверьте также, установлены ли на вашем компьютере следующие программы:
- Git (команды Git будут использоваться во время установки Flutter SDK)
- PowerShell (входит в стандартные программы Windows)
Шаг 2: Скачайте Flutter SDK
Перейдите на официальный сайт Flutter и скачайте архив с Flutter SDK для Windows. Выберите версию, соответствующую вашей операционной системе и нажмите «Скачать».
Шаг 3: Разархивируйте архив
После скачивания разархивируйте скачанный архив в удобную для вас директорию. Рекомендуется разархивировать архив в корневую директорию диска C: (например, C:\flutter).
Шаг 4: Добавьте Flutter в переменную среды PATH
Чтобы использовать Flutter из командной строки, вам необходимо добавить путь до директории flutter\bin в переменную среды PATH. Для этого выполните следующие шаги:
- Откройте «Панель управления» и перейдите в «Система и безопасность».
- В разделе «Система» выберите «Дополнительные параметры системы».
- На открывшейся вкладке «Дополнительно» нажмите на кнопку «Переменные среды».
- В разделе «Переменные среды» найдите переменную PATH и выберите «Изменить».
- Нажмите на кнопку «Новый» и введите путь до директории flutter\bin (например, C:\flutter\bin).
- Подтвердите изменения и закройте все окна.
Шаг 5: Запуск Flutter Doctor
После добавления Flutter в переменную среды PATH откройте командную строку и введите команду flutter doctor. Эта команда проверит настройки вашей системы и установит необходимые компоненты. Если всё сделано правильно, вы увидите сообщение о готовности к разработке на Flutter.
Поздравляем, у вас установлен Flutter SDK и вы готовы начать разработку в этом потрясающем фреймворке!
Установка Android Studio
Для разработки приложений на Flutter требуется установить Android Studio, интегрированную среду разработки для платформы Android. В этом разделе мы рассмотрим пошаговую инструкцию по установке Android Studio на операционную систему Windows.
Шаг 1: Перейдите на официальный сайт Android Studio по ссылке https://developer.android.com/studio.
Шаг 2: Нажмите на кнопку «Download Android Studio» для скачивания установочного файла.
Шаг 3: После скачивания запустите установочный файл.
Шаг 4: В появившемся окне выберите путь установки Android Studio на вашем компьютере и нажмите кнопку «Next».
Шаг 5: Выберите компоненты для установки. Оставьте выбранными все предустановленные компоненты и нажмите кнопку «Next».
Шаг 6: В следующем окне выберите свои настройки, например, язык интерфейса, и нажмите кнопку «Next».
Шаг 7: Проверьте выбранные настройки и нажмите кнопку «Install».
Шаг 8: Дождитесь завершения установки Android Studio.
Шаг 9: После установки запустите Android Studio.
Теперь у вас установлена среда разработки Android Studio, необходимая для разработки приложений на Flutter.
Настройка переменных среды
Перед установкой Flutter на Windows необходимо настроить переменные среды. Это позволит вам использовать инструменты Flutter и Dart из любой папки на вашем компьютере.
Чтобы настроить переменные среды, следуйте этим шагам:
- Откройте «Системные настройки» и перейдите на вкладку «Дополнительные настройки системы».
- Нажмите на кнопку «Переменные среды».
- В разделе «Переменные среды пользователя» нажмите на кнопку «Создать».
- Введите имя переменной «FLUTTER_HOME» и укажите путь к папке, в которую вы установили Flutter.
- Нажмите «OK», чтобы сохранить переменную.
- Выберите переменную «Path» и нажмите «Изменить».
- Нажмите «Новый» и введите «%FLUTTER_HOME%\bin» в поле «Значение переменной».
- Нажмите «ОК» для сохранения изменений.
Теперь переменные среды настроены правильно, и вы можете использовать команду «flutter» из любой папки в командной строке.
Проверка и настройка Flutter
Прежде чем начать разработку с использованием Flutter, необходимо проверить и настроить вашу среду разработки. В этом разделе мы рассмотрим несколько шагов, которые включают в себя проверку установки Dart SDK, установку Flutter SDK и настройку вашей среды разработки.
1. Проверка установки Dart SDK
Для работы с Flutter необходимо установить Dart SDK. Вы можете проверить, установлен ли Dart SDK на вашей системе, выполнив следующую команду в командной строке:
dart --version
Если Dart SDK уже установлен, вы должны увидеть информацию о версии Dart SDK.
Если Dart SDK не установлен, вам нужно установить его, перейдя на страницу https://dart.dev/get-dart и следуя инструкциям в зависимости от вашей операционной системы.
2. Установка Flutter SDK
Для установки Flutter SDK необходимо скачать его с официального сайта Flutter. Вы можете найти последнюю версию Flutter SDK на странице https://flutter.dev/docs/get-started/install.
После завершения загрузки архива с Flutter SDK, распакуйте его в удобную для вас папку.
3. Настройка вашей среды разработки
После установки Flutter SDK необходимо настроить вашу среду разработки, чтобы она могла использовать Flutter для разработки.
Если вы используете IDE Android Studio, откройте настройки IDE и перейдите к разделу «Плагины». Найдите и установите плагин Flutter, а затем перезапустите IDE.
Если вы используете Visual Studio Code, откройте его и установите плагин Flutter, перейдя в меню «Расширения» и выполните поиск «flutter». Установите первый результат, затем перезапустите Visual Studio Code.
Если вы используете другую IDE или редактор кода, посетите официальный сайт Flutter, чтобы найти дополнительную информацию о настройке вашей среды разработки.
После выполнения всех этих шагов ваша среда разработки будет готова к использованию Flutter и вы сможете начать создавать красивые и мощные приложения с помощью Flutter.
Установка Android Virtual Device
- Откройте Android Studio и выберите «Configure» в главном меню.
- В раскрывающемся меню выберите «AVD Manager».
- Нажмите на кнопку «Create Virtual Device».
- Выберите устройство, для которого вы хотите создать эмулятор, и нажмите «Next».
- Выберите желаемую версию Android и нажмите «Next».
- Выберите необходимые характеристики устройства, такие как тип экрана, разрешение и ориентацию, и нажмите «Next».
- Выберите системное образец, который соответствует выбранной версии Android, и нажмите «Next».
- Назовите свое устройство и нажмите «Finish».
В результате будет создан Android Virtual Device, который вы сможете использовать для запуска и тестирования своих Flutter-приложений на эмуляторе. А для запуска Android Virtual Device достаточно выбрать его в списке в AVD Manager и нажать «Play».
Создание и проверка первого Flutter проекта
После успешной установки Flutter на вашей операционной системе Windows, вы готовы создать свой первый Flutter проект. В этом разделе мы рассмотрим, как создать новый проект и проверить его работоспособность.
Шаг 1: Откройте командную строку или терминал и перейдите в директорию, в которой вы хотите создать свой проект Flutter.
Шаг 2: Введите следующую команду в командную строку или терминал, чтобы создать новый проект Flutter:
flutter create my_first_flutter_project
В этой команде мы используем команду create
, чтобы создать новый проект, а «my_first_flutter_project» — это имя вашего проекта. Вы можете выбрать любое имя, которое вам нравится.
Шаг 3: После выполнения команды, Flutter создаст все необходимые файлы и структуру каталогов для вашего проекта. Перейдите в каталог вашего проекта с помощью команды cd my_first_flutter_project
.
Шаг 4: Теперь, чтобы убедиться, что ваш проект работает, введите следующую команду:
flutter run
Эта команда запустит ваш проект Flutter и откроет его в симуляторе или подключенном устройстве.
Шаг 5: Поздравляем! Вы только что успешно создали и проверили свой первый Flutter проект. Теперь вы можете начать разрабатывать свое приложение, изменяя файл lib/main.dart
вашего проекта.
Во время разработки приложения вы можете использовать команду flutter run
, чтобы проверить изменения в реальном времени.
В этом разделе мы рассмотрели пошаговую инструкцию по созданию и проверке первого Flutter проекта. Теперь у вас есть основа, чтобы начать создавать потрясающие мобильные приложения с использованием Flutter.